What Are Cloud Data Platforms?
Cloud data platforms are integrated systems that allow organizations to store, manage, process, and analyze data in the cloud. Unlike traditional databases, these platforms provide elastic scalability, meaning they can automatically adjust resources based on demand.
They typically include:
- Data storage (data lakes and warehouses)
- Data processing engines
- Analytics and visualization tools
- Security and governance features
- Integration with other cloud services
These platforms eliminate the need for costly hardware investments and allow businesses to focus on innovation rather than infrastructure management.

Best Cloud Data Platforms for Scalable Business Solutions
1. Amazon Web Services (AWS) Data Platform
AWS offers a comprehensive suite of data services, including data lakes, warehouses, and analytics tools.
Key Features:
- Amazon S3 for storage
- Amazon Redshift for data warehousing
- AWS Glue for data integration
- Real-time analytics with Kinesis
Benefits:
- Highly scalable infrastructure
- Global availability
- Extensive ecosystem of tools
Best For:
Enterprises requiring a wide range of services and global scalability.
2. Microsoft Azure Data Platform
Microsoft Azure provides powerful data services tailored for enterprise environments.
Key Features:
- Azure Synapse Analytics
- Azure Data Factory
- Integration with Power BI
- Strong hybrid cloud capabilities
Benefits:
- Seamless integration with Microsoft products
- Advanced analytics and AI tools
- Strong enterprise security
Best For:
Organizations already using Microsoft ecosystems.
3. Google Cloud Data Platform
Google Cloud is known for its advanced analytics and machine learning capabilities.
Key Features:
- BigQuery for serverless data warehousing
- Dataflow for stream and batch processing
- AI and ML integration
- Real-time analytics
Benefits:
- High-speed query processing
- Serverless architecture reduces management overhead
- Strong AI capabilities
Best For:
Businesses focused on analytics and machine learning.
4. Snowflake
Snowflake is a cloud-native data platform designed for scalability and performance.
Key Features:
- Multi-cloud support
- Separate storage and compute
- Data sharing capabilities
- Automatic scaling
Benefits:
- High performance
- Flexible pricing
- Easy data sharing across organizations
Best For:
Companies needing a modern, flexible data warehouse.
5. Databricks
Databricks is built on Apache Spark and focuses on big data and AI.
Key Features:
- Unified analytics platform
- Delta Lake architecture
- Collaborative notebooks
- Machine learning integration
Benefits:
- Ideal for data engineering and data science
- Scalable big data processing
- Strong collaboration tools
Best For:
Organizations working heavily with big data and AI projects.
6. Oracle Cloud Data Platform
Oracle offers a robust suite of data management tools in the cloud.
Key Features:
- Autonomous Database
- Data integration services
- Advanced analytics tools
- Strong security features
Benefits:
- High reliability
- Automated management
- Enterprise-grade performance
Best For:
Large enterprises requiring high-performance databases.
7. IBM Cloud Data Platform
IBM provides a data platform focused on AI and hybrid cloud environments.
Key Features:
- Watson AI integration
- Data governance tools
- Hybrid cloud capabilities
- Advanced analytics
Benefits:
- Strong AI capabilities
- Flexible deployment options
- Robust governance features
Best For:
Organizations focusing on AI-driven insights.
Comparing Cloud Data Platforms
| Platform | Strengths | Ideal Use Case |
|---|---|---|
| AWS | Extensive services | Large-scale enterprise solutions |
| Azure | Microsoft integration | Hybrid environments |
| Google Cloud | Analytics & AI | Data-driven organizations |
| Snowflake | Scalability & simplicity | Data warehousing |
| Databricks | Big data & AI | Data science workflows |
| Oracle | High-performance databases | Enterprise applications |
| IBM | AI & governance | Hybrid cloud & AI projects |
